AI Contract Overview
This contract involves specialized maintenance services for electric forklift battery systems, focusing on charging diagnostics and electrical safety inspections. It also includes the management and documentation of MPJ records related to these systems. The work is designated as a subcontract and falls under the NAICS code 811121, which covers automotive repair and maintenance services, indicating a technical and specialized scope of work centered on ensuring the safe and efficient operation of electric forklift batteries. Issued by the Department of Defense through Mschq Norfolk, the contract became available on June 1, 2026, with a response deadline set for June 15, 2026, at 2:00 PM. The place of performance is identified by the zip code 23511, although specific city and state details are not provided. No set-aside type is indicated, and there is no designated point of contact listed. This opportunity is accessible for review through the SAM.gov portal, allowing interested subcontractors to evaluate and respond within the specified timeframe.
